Charter Buses to NAU Lumberjacks Football Games at the Skydome
Lumberjacks football draws big crowds to the Skydome (1701 S San Francisco St, Flagstaff, AZ 86011), and the parking situation around the NAU campus on game days is exactly as tight as you'd expect for a university sitting inside a mountain city. Lots on Ring Road fill well before kickoff, and the residential streets surrounding South San Francisco Street and Lone Tree Road quickly become a patchwork of permit zones and cones.
A charter bus rental for NAU football drops your group right at the campus perimeter and picks everyone up when the final whistle blows — no hunting for a spot, no waiting in a post-game exit line that backs up onto Milton Road. For large alumni groups or booster club travel, a 40- to 56-passenger motorcoach with reclining seats, climate control, onboard WiFi, and undercarriage luggage bays keeps everyone comfortable on the way in and the way home. Confirm current charter bus drop-off protocols directly with NAU visitor parking and University Transit Services before your game day visit.
One published NAU Skydome event plan places loading and unloading on the north side of the building off McConnell Drive, while general parking is listed in P66 south of the Skydome; use the event-specific instructions before finalizing your meeting point. Where do charter buses drop off at the NAU Skydome?
Charter bus drop-off at the Skydome (1701 S San Francisco St, Flagstaff, AZ 86011) is coordinated on an event-by-event basis through NAU Parking and Transit Services. One published NAU event plan directs loading and unloading to the north side of the Skydome off McConnell Drive, but drop-off zones and bus parking assignments can shift depending on the event, so Flagstaffminibuscompany.com strongly recommends checking the NAU visitor parking and University Transit Services page and contacting the department directly before game day to confirm current logistics for your specific event.

Is parking really that difficult near NAU on game days?
Yes — Flagstaff's compact mountain geography means NAU campus parking lots on Ring Road and the surrounding streets fill well before kickoff or tip-off, and the residential permit zones on Lone Tree Road and South San Francisco Street leave very few overflow options. A charter bus or minibus rental sidesteps the whole situation: your group gets dropped at the campus perimeter, and the bus handles the parking so you don't have to. NAU visitor parking lists P66 at the Skydome at $4 per hour or $10 per day, while garage parking is listed at $4 per hour or $16 per day; confirm current game-day restrictions with NAU visitor parking and University Transit Services before your visit.
